MailChannels features and specs
Strong Email Deliverability MailChannels specializes in outbound email filtering and delivery, helping ensure that legitimate emails reach recipients' inboxes by managing IP reputation and filtering out spam before it leaves your network.
Easy Integration with Cloudflare Workers MailChannels offers a popular integration with Cloudflare Workers, allowing developers to send transactional emails directly from serverless functions without needing to manage their own email infrastructure.
No SMTP Credentials Required (Workers Integration) When used with Cloudflare Workers, MailChannels eliminates the need to manage SMTP credentials, simplifying the setup process and reducing the risk of credential leaks or misuse.
Designed for Hosting Providers MailChannels is purpose-built for web hosting providers, offering robust outbound spam filtering that prevents compromised accounts on shared hosting from damaging the IP reputation of the entire server or network.
Abuse Detection and Mitigation The platform includes sophisticated abuse detection capabilities that can automatically identify and block compromised accounts or scripts sending spam, protecting both the sender's reputation and downstream recipients.
Possible disadvantages of MailChannels
Limited Free Tier Availability MailChannels discontinued its free Cloudflare Workers integration in late 2023, requiring users to move to a paid plan, which may be a drawback for small projects or individual developers who relied on the free sending capability.
Pricing Transparency MailChannels' pricing is not always clearly listed on their website, often requiring potential customers to contact sales for quotes, which can make it difficult to evaluate costs upfront compared to competitors with transparent pricing pages.
Smaller Ecosystem and Community Compared to major transactional email providers like SendGrid, Mailgun, or Amazon SES, MailChannels has a smaller user community, which means fewer tutorials, third-party integrations, and community support resources are available.
Limited Marketing Email Features MailChannels is primarily focused on outbound filtering and transactional email delivery rather than marketing email features. It lacks built-in tools for email campaigns, templates, analytics dashboards, and subscriber management that competitors offer.
Vendor Lock-in Concerns Relying on MailChannels, especially through the Cloudflare Workers integration, can create dependency on their specific infrastructure. If pricing changes or service disruptions occur, migrating to another provider may require significant rework of email-sending logic.
